![]() Parts of the book are the Ya-Ya women thinking about events in the past. Most of the book is Sidda thinking about events in the scrapbook and talking to the four women. When Sidda was a child, Vivi beat Sidda with a belt leaving scars. Sidda wants to better understand her mother and their relationship. She asks Vivi to send her the Ya-Ya scrapbook. Sidda postpones her wedding to Connor because she fears she does not know how to love. The main story is Vivi, one of the Ya-Ya women. ![]() It was just wonderfully close loving friendship.
